Home
last modified time | relevance | path

Searched refs:PetscObjectList (Results 1 – 12 of 12) sorted by relevance

/petsc/src/sys/objects/
H A Dolist.c29 PetscErrorCode PetscObjectListRemoveReference(PetscObjectList *fl, const char name[]) in PetscObjectListRemoveReference()
31 PetscObjectList nlist; in PetscObjectListRemoveReference()
69 PetscErrorCode PetscObjectListAdd(PetscObjectList *fl, const char name[], PetscObject obj) in PetscObjectListAdd()
71 PetscObjectList olist, nlist, prev; in PetscObjectListAdd()
138 PetscErrorCode PetscObjectListDestroy(PetscObjectList *ifl) in PetscObjectListDestroy()
140 PetscObjectList tmp, fl; in PetscObjectListDestroy()
176 PetscErrorCode PetscObjectListFind(PetscObjectList fl, const char name[], PetscObject *obj) in PetscObjectListFind()
215 PetscErrorCode PetscObjectListReverseFind(PetscObjectList fl, PetscObject obj, const char *name[], … in PetscObjectListReverseFind()
248 PetscErrorCode PetscObjectListDuplicate(PetscObjectList fl, PetscObjectList *nl) in PetscObjectListDuplicate()
/petsc/doc/developers/
H A Dobjects.md301 typedef struct _PetscObjectList* PetscObjectList;
305 PetscObjectList next;
313 int PetscObjectListAdd(PetscObjectList *fl,const char *name,PetscObject obj);
314 int PetscObjectListDestroy(PetscObjectList *fl);
315 int PetscObjectListFind(PetscObjectList fl,const char *name,PetscObject *obj)
316 int PetscObjectListDuplicate(PetscObjectList fl,PetscObjectList *nl);
320 PetscObjectList if the argument `fl` points to a NULL.
/petsc/include/petsc/private/
H A Ddmswarmimpl.h62 PetscObjectList cellDMs;
H A Dpetscimpl.h118 PetscObjectList olist;
1641 PetscObjectList next;
H A Dtsimpl.h175 PetscObjectList resizetransferobjs;
/petsc/src/sys/tests/
H A Dex15.cxx84 PetscObjectList olist; in main()
/petsc/include/
H A Dpetscsystypes.h855 typedef struct _n_PetscObjectList *PetscObjectList; typedef
H A Dpetscsys.h1640 PETSC_EXTERN PetscErrorCode PetscObjectListDestroy(PetscObjectList *);
1641 PETSC_EXTERN PetscErrorCode PetscObjectListFind(PetscObjectList, const char[], PetscObject *);
1642 PETSC_EXTERN PetscErrorCode PetscObjectListReverseFind(PetscObjectList, PetscObject, const char *[]…
1643 PETSC_EXTERN PetscErrorCode PetscObjectListAdd(PetscObjectList *, const char[], PetscObject);
1644 PETSC_EXTERN PetscErrorCode PetscObjectListRemoveReference(PetscObjectList *, const char[]);
1645 PETSC_EXTERN PetscErrorCode PetscObjectListDuplicate(PetscObjectList, PetscObjectList *);
/petsc/doc/changes/
H A D34.md20 `PetscFunctionList` and `PetscObjectList`.
/petsc/src/mat/utils/
H A Dgcreate.c436 PetscObjectList olist; in MatHeaderMerge()
/petsc/src/dm/impls/swarm/
H A Dswarm.c1489 PetscObjectList next = swarm->cellDMs; in DMSwarmGetCellDMNames()
/petsc/src/ts/interface/
H A Dts.c3935 PetscObjectList tmp; in TSResizeGetVecArray()